Compliance Documents Required to

2. Toluene Export Customs Declaration

in the process of toluene export, companies need to prepare the following documents:

export contract: Clarify the rights and responsibilities of buyers and sellers, including product name, quantity, specifications, price and other information. Based on my observations, Commercial Invoice: List the name, quantity, unit price, total amount and other information of the goods in detail, and affix the company's official seal. Packing List (Packing List): List the details of each batch of goods, including packaging, quantity, weight, etc. Bill of Lading (Bill of Lading): A transport document issued by the carrier certifying that the goods have been loaded and shipped to the designated port. Certificate of Export Inspection (COI): A certificate issued by the inspection and quarantine agency showing that the goods meet the condition and security standards of the exporting country. But From what I've seen, In fact Certificate of Origin (COC): Certificate of the place of production of the goods, usually issued by a government department or chamber of commerce in the exporting country. But From what I've seen, security Data Sheet (MSDS): Detailed information on the physical characteristics, hazards, safe storage and transportation standards of toluene. Environmental Statement or Certificate of Compliance: Prove that the production and transportation process of toluene meets ecological preservation standards and prevent being punished due to ecological preservation issues. Generally speaking Export License (if required) some countries implement a licensing system to the export of hazardous chemicals and need to apply to relevant permits in advance. And From what I've seen, Compliance Documents Required to

3. But Toluene Import Customs Declaration

compared to exports, the documentation standards to import declarations toluene are slightly different:

import contract clarify the specifications, quantity, price and other information of the goods as the basic basis to customs declaration. But Commercial Invoice: Similar to exports, the seller's official seal is required and the goods information is listed in detail. In my experience, Furthermore Packing List (Packing List): The same as to export, the packaging and quantity of the goods need to be listed in detail. Bill of Lading (Bill of Lading): To prove that the goods have arrived at the port of destination and are ready to customs clearance. But Based on my observations, Import declaration form (Customs Declaration form): Fill in by the importer, declare the goods information in detail, and stamp the customs seal. Certificate of Import Inspection (COI): To certify that the goods meet the condition and security standards of the importing country. security Data Sheet (MSDS): Same as the export, the danger and security of toluene should be explained in detail. Environmental Statement or Certificate of Compliance: To prove that the import and consumption of toluene meets the ecological preservation standards of the importing country. And Import Licence (if required) some countries implement a licensing system to the import of hazardous chemicals and need to apply to relevant permits in advance. Matters needing attention in import and export declaration of toluene in

4. But From what I've seen, Moreover Ensure consistency of documents

The information of the goods in the customs declaration documents must be completely consistent, including the name, quantity, specifications, etc. But , to prevent the delay or return of customs clearance due to inconsistent information. Factual declaration of the environment of the goods

Toluene is a hazardous chemical, and companies need to truthfully declare its hazardous environment in the customs declaration documents to prevent legal risks caused by concealment or underreporting. Specifically Compliance with relevant regulations and standards

Different countries and regions have different standards to the import and export of hazardous chemicals. From what I've seen, Additionally companies need to understand and comply with relevant regulations and standards in advance. For example Choose a professional customs agent

Due to the complex compliance standards involved in the import and export of toluene, companies is able to choose experienced customs agents to ensure the smooth progress of the customs declaration process. And
